Light colored sand. When I 1st got my FH I used black sand and he turned black! It looked sort of cool but very odd. I hate gravel. Too much gunk gets caught down in it.
 
Camphilophus;3401637; said:
Sand is not a good substrate for flowerhorns. They prefer gravel so they can move it around. You'll end up getting better colors out of your fish if you use multicolored gravel too.
